Posted February 26, 2007 Hello all, my ISP disconnects me every 12-15 hours, then i auto reconnect again while my client is still running and i get another IP. To continue my downloads its very crucial for me to have an IP auto update every 10-20 minutes (not only when i restart my client). I think Zion has a box for auto-updates every 10 mins. Posted April 24, 2007 i have dynamic ip too and don't have any errors ... i go further .... i've regged a dynamic dns address for free and set my router to update it when connecting ---> actually i use "don't update IP" every startup and put there my dns name ... could be a solution if you have a router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
